Industries Offering Opportunities for Retired Professionals
Several industries are increasingly recognizing the value that retired professionals bring, particularly in roles that require extensive experience and specialized knowledge. One prominent sector is education, where many retirees are turning to teaching or tutoring. For instance, in cities like Pune, retired teachers and professors are engaging in mentoring roles in various educational institutions, helping young minds navigate their academic journeys. Additionally, organizations such as the Indian Institute of Management (IIM) in Ahmedabad often invite retired professionals to share their insights through guest lectures and workshops.
Another sector ripe with opportunities is consulting. Retired professionals from sectors such as banking and finance have found success in offering consulting services to startups and small businesses. In Mumbai, for example, many retired finance executives provide strategic advice to new enterprises, helping them navigate the complexities of financial management. This not only allows retirees to remain active in their field but also fosters a sense of fulfillment as they guide the next generation of entrepreneurs.
Furthermore, the IT sector has seen a growing demand for retired professionals, particularly those with extensive project management experience. Companies in Bangalore are hiring retirees on a contract basis for short-term projects, leveraging their expertise while also offering them flexibility. This trend highlights the adaptability of the workforce and the increasing acceptance of retired professionals in roles that were previously considered reserved for younger employees.
Geographical Insights: Major Cities and Sectors
When exploring employment opportunities for retired persons in India, it is essential to consider specific cities and sectors that are particularly welcoming to retirees. Cities like Hyderabad and Chennai have seen a surge in demand for retired professionals in the healthcare sector. Many hospitals and clinics are looking for experienced retired doctors and nurses to provide part-time consultation and training. This not only benefits the healthcare system but also allows retirees to continue contributing to a field they are passionate about.
In the realm of finance, Delhi stands out as a city where retirees can find various opportunities in both corporate and advisory roles. With numerous banks and financial institutions headquartered in the capital, retirees can leverage their extensive knowledge in finance and investment to assist firms in strategic decision-making processes. Moreover, sectors like real estate and insurance are also on the lookout for retired professionals who can bring their expertise to the table.
Additionally, the hospitality industry in Goa has opened its doors to retired professionals seeking a change of pace. Many hotels and resorts are hiring retirees for customer service roles, event management, and even supervisory positions. This shift not only enriches the hospitality sector but also provides retirees with a chance to engage with tourists and share their rich cultural heritage.
Practical Advice for Retired Professionals Seeking Employment
For retired professionals considering re-entering the workforce, it is essential to approach the job market with a strategic mindset. First and foremost, updating your resume to highlight relevant skills and experiences is crucial. Tailoring your application to reflect your strengths and how they align with potential roles can make a significant difference in capturing the attention of employers.
Networking is another critical aspect of finding employment opportunities for retired persons in India. Engaging with former colleagues, attending industry events, and joining professional groups can provide valuable connections and open doors to new opportunities. Additionally, leveraging online platforms like LinkedIn can significantly enhance visibility and connect retirees with potential employers looking for experienced professionals.
Exploring freelance opportunities can also be a great way for retired individuals to remain engaged while enjoying the flexibility of choosing their workload. Websites such as Upwork and Freelancer offer platforms where retirees can find projects that match their skills, from writing and consulting to graphic design. Furthermore, considering part-time positions can provide a balanced approach that allows retired professionals to ease back into the workforce without undue stress.

Q: What types of employment opportunities are available for retired persons in India?
A: Retired persons in India can find employment opportunities in various sectors, including education, consulting, healthcare, and hospitality. Many companies seek experienced professionals for part-time, freelance, or advisory roles that leverage their expertise.
Q: How can retired professionals update their skills for new job opportunities?
A: Retired professionals can update their skills through online courses, workshops, and webinars that focus on relevant topics in their industry. Additionally, many universities and institutions offer short-term courses specifically designed for professionals looking to refresh their knowledge.
Q: Is freelancing a viable option for retired professionals?
A: Yes, freelancing is a viable option for retired professionals as it offers flexibility and allows them to choose projects that align with their skills and interests. Platforms like Upwork and Freelancer make it easy to find work that fits their expertise.
Q: What are some challenges retired professionals may face when seeking employment?
A: Some challenges include age-related biases, gaps in employment history, and adapting to new technologies. However, emphasizing relevant experience and continuously learning can help overcome these obstacles.
